Description
This third edition of "Essentials of Clinical Geriatrics" aims to provide primary care physicians and residents in geriatric medicine with a complete clinical guide to treating elderly patients. Revised and updated, it covers all aspects of the diagnosis and management of common problems presenting in elderly patients. The book also covers many of the non-clinical problems which often cause complications in the patient, such as social and environmental problems, dementia, incontinence, and instability and falling.
